Dorian Finney-Smith (leg) starting for Dallas Saturday; Tim Hardaway Jr. to bench
Dallas Mavericks forward Dorian Finney-Smith is in the lineup Saturday in the team's game against the Washington Wizards.
Finney-Smith sat Thursday due to a leg injury, but he's been given the green light to return to the court. He's also starting in his first game back, and Tim Hardaway Jr. will revert to a bench role.
Our models project Finney-Smith for 9.6 points, 5.5 rebounds, 1.5 assists and 22.0 FanDuel points across 31.7 minutes of action.
